Output efed904f5114a0600a6b164541050d6241ab66cd44c19d679d94fad689eceb2a:0

value
30326204
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 257e5276f3366dd396e8df97003d4edc98dc9d78 OP_EQUALVERIFY OP_CHECKSIG
address
14RFL7ZCAZ2DZmH4sYwp7quorteywfzQTd
transaction
efed904f5114a0600a6b164541050d6241ab66cd44c19d679d94fad689eceb2a
confirmations
339153
spent
true